Msekera Agromet vs Saikhan-Ovoo Climate & Distance Between

Mongolia flag
  • The distance between Msekera Agromet, Zambia and Saikhan-Ovoo, Mongolia is approximately 9,689 km or 6,021 mi.
  • To reach Msekera Agromet in this distance one would set out from Saikhan-Ovoo bearing 247.2° or WSW and follow the great circles arc to approach Msekera Agromet bearing 221.7° or SW .
  • Msekera Agromet has a tropical wet and dry/ savanna climate with dry winters (Aw) whereas Saikhan-Ovoo has a mid-latitude cool desert climate (BWk).
  • Msekera Agromet is in or near the subtropical dry forest biome whereas Saikhan-Ovoo is in or near the boreal dry scrub biome.
  • The average temperature is 20.5 °C (36.8°F) warmer.
  • Average monthly temperatures vary by 33 °C (59.4°F) less in Msekera Agromet. The continentality subtype is truly hyperoceanic as opposed to truly continental.
  • Total annual precipitation averages 899.6 mm (35.4 in) more which is equivalent to 899.6 l/m² (22.08 US gal/ft²) or 8,996,000 l/ha (961,732 US gal/ac) more. About 9 as much.
  • The altitude of the sun at midday is overall 26.9° higher in Msekera Agromet than in Saikhan-Ovoo.
